About Shriver Job Corps Center 

The Shriver Job Corps Center provides students with the opportunity to earn their High School Diploma or Equivalent (GED), and hands-on training in the following areas: Advanced Computer Systems Administration, Advanced Transportation Service Worker, Various Computer Services, Carpentry, CNA, Automotive Maintenance, Millwright Welding, Office Administration and Security & Protective Services. 

Our 21-acre campus is nestled away minutes off of RTE 2, and 2A on Jackson Road in Devens MA. We service between 200 and 300 dorm students ages 16 to 24 years old at any given time with rolling admissions weekly. Our staff value the student experience and often cite the personal impact of what we do as a major factor of employment satisfaction. In addition, we have amenities that are open for staff to utilize such as a gym, basketball courts, full service cafeteria and more.

About Adams and Associates 

Adams and Associates is a 100% employee-owned company that is service-focused and outcome-driven. We began as a small business formed in 1990 with the sole mission of operating at-risk youth and children's programs for local, state, and federal governmental agencies. Today, we are one of the largest workforce providers involved in the federal Job Corps program! 

Adams and Associates employs more than 2,000 staff members across the United States. Each year we provide academic, vocational training, and placement services to approximately 9,000 young people from ages 16 to 24 primarily in a residential setting. Our academic and career technical training programs are accredited and lead to national industry-recognized credentials.
